GS7B0188R7JDT Description
GS7B0188R7JDT Description
The GS7B0188R7JDT from TT Electronics/IRC is a high-performance ceramic resistor network designed for precision applications in demanding electronic circuits. This 14-pin narrow SOIC package integrates 13 bussed resistors with a 88.7Ω resistance value, offering a ±5% absolute tolerance and ±0.5% ratio tolerance for consistent performance. Built with thin-film technology, it ensures low noise and high stability, making it ideal for analog and digital signal processing. The device operates over a wide temperature range of -55°C to +125°C, with a derated power range of 70°C to 125°C, and features a 100V maximum voltage rating. Its SOIC package (8.66mm x 5.99mm x 1.45mm) provides a compact footprint for space-constrained designs.
GS7B0188R7JDT Features
- 13 bussed resistors in a 14-pin SOIC package for efficient circuit design.
- Thin-film technology ensures ±100ppm/°C temperature coefficient for minimal drift.
- High power rating: 0.7W total (0.05W per resistor) for robust performance.
- Gull-wing termination enables reliable surface-mount assembly.
- Ceramic case enhances thermal and mechanical durability.
- Non-automotive and non-PPAP compliant, suitable for industrial and commercial use.
- 1.27mm terminal pitch for compatibility with standard PCB layouts.
